新聞中心
問題描述
用戶在使用服務(wù)器VPS時(shí),無法訪問網(wǎng)站,可能是由于以下原因?qū)е碌模?/p>

1、服務(wù)器宕機(jī)或斷網(wǎng);
2、域名解析錯(cuò)誤;
3、網(wǎng)站文件損壞或丟失;
4、服務(wù)器防火墻設(shè)置不當(dāng)。
本文將針對(duì)以上原因,提供相應(yīng)的解決方法。
解決方案及步驟
1、檢查服務(wù)器狀態(tài)
需要檢查服務(wù)器的狀態(tài),確保服務(wù)器正常運(yùn)行,可以通過以下命令查看服務(wù)器狀態(tài):
sudo service nginx status
如果服務(wù)器宕機(jī)或斷網(wǎng),請(qǐng)檢查網(wǎng)絡(luò)連接并修復(fù)。
2、檢查域名解析
如果服務(wù)器正常運(yùn)行,但仍然無法訪問網(wǎng)站,可能是域名解析出現(xiàn)問題,可以通過以下命令查看域名解析情況:
ping www.example.com nslookup www.example.com
如果解析出錯(cuò),請(qǐng)檢查DNS配置或聯(lián)系域名服務(wù)商進(jìn)行修復(fù)。
3、檢查網(wǎng)站文件完整性
如果域名解析正常,但網(wǎng)站仍無法訪問,可能是網(wǎng)站文件損壞或丟失,可以通過以下命令查看網(wǎng)站文件是否存在:
ls -l /var/www/html/index.php
如果文件不存在或損壞,請(qǐng)恢復(fù)備份或重新部署網(wǎng)站。
4、檢查服務(wù)器防火墻設(shè)置
如果以上方法都無法解決問題,可能是服務(wù)器防火墻設(shè)置不當(dāng),可以通過以下命令查看防火墻狀態(tài):
sudo iptables -L -n -v
如果防火墻阻止了網(wǎng)站訪問,請(qǐng)根據(jù)實(shí)際需求修改防火墻規(guī)則,允許網(wǎng)站訪問,如果需要開放80端口,可以執(zhí)行以下命令:
sudo iptables -I INPUT -p tcp --dport 80 -j ACCEPT sudo service iptables save
相關(guān)問題與解答
1、如何查看服務(wù)器CPU使用率?
答:可以使用以下命令查看服務(wù)器CPU使用率:
top
或者安裝htop工具:
sudo apt-get install htop
然后運(yùn)行htop,即可實(shí)時(shí)查看服務(wù)器CPU使用率。
2、如何查看服務(wù)器內(nèi)存使用情況?
答:可以使用以下命令查看服務(wù)器內(nèi)存使用情況:
free -m
該命令會(huì)以MB為單位顯示內(nèi)存使用情況,還可以安裝meminfo工具查看更詳細(xì)的內(nèi)存信息:
sudo apt-get install meminfo
當(dāng)前文章:服務(wù)器VPS無法訪問網(wǎng)站如何解決
URL標(biāo)題:http://www.5511xx.com/article/coposhd.html


咨詢
建站咨詢
